FACTORS INFLUENCING EMPLOYEES PERFORMANCE IN OUT SOURCING INDUSTRY AND IMPACT ON EMPLOYEES Authors: Nikita Chitlangia
ABSTRACT
The last two decades have witnessed a rapid increase in the globalization of business.
Developments in the fields of information technology, manufacturing technology, transportation,
trade liberalization, emergence of new markets and increase in foreign direct investments have
contributed significantly in this regard. The concept of a 'global village' has now become a
reality.
The Indian business Process Outsourcing industry is in the throes of evolutionary change
as the US recession finally begins to take its toll. The industry is looking at various strategies and
technologies to survive and thrive amid growing pressure of the US recession.
The present study will be conducted with the objective to analyze the impact of economic
slowdown on the employee’s performance of BPO sector in India. Therefore, In order to achieve
this objective a self administered questionnaire will be designed to analyze the employee’s
performance due to the impact of economic slowdown, level of job security and other related
conditions.
